Output c85b1c0e2289f845a5b07cf917b7f261cdf8b6ac679875e52d7eac97443512a8:103

value
83601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dfd5eee74d63da0e67f04750099033dcd88ca92 OP_EQUAL
address
3Ednj753BWncXj3F8E1nK2eiBXdhFC24TP
transaction
c85b1c0e2289f845a5b07cf917b7f261cdf8b6ac679875e52d7eac97443512a8
spent
true